Transaction 8eda73ec79063eccc0cdd1a90321c72bfb4b942519ea8717ac6dd656c92861c6
3 Input
2 Outputs
- 8eda73ec79063eccc0cdd1a90321c72bfb4b942519ea8717ac6dd656c92861c6:0
- 8eda73ec79063eccc0cdd1a90321c72bfb4b942519ea8717ac6dd656c92861c6:1
value 56906
address 197mmGHGuGRjYyGKf8hQNJrrWeeEWYewyE
value 3192500
address 3FHhJdzSbAYprMetBJMXhPNXrnchMXC1rW